报告:
Signal detection and RF parameter estimation have received great interest in recent years due to the need for spectrum sensing in rapidly growing cognitive radio and cyber security research. In most conventional signal detection and RF parameter estimation work, the target signal is often assumed to be a single primary user signal without overlap in spectrum with other signals. However, in a spectrally congested environment or a spectrally contested environment which often occurs in cyber security applications, multiple signals are often mixed together with significant overlap in spectrum. In this talk, we present our recent work on the feasibility of using a second order spectrum correlation function (SCF) cyclostationary feature to perform mixed signal detection in spectrally congested environment. We also evaluate the detection and estimation performance of the proposed algorithm in various channel conditions and signal mixture scenarios. Additionally, we use software defined radio to implement and demonstrate our cyclostationary analysis based mixed signal detection algorithms.
 
报告人简介
 
Speaker : Zhiqiang Wu (Wright State University)
 
Dr. Zhiqiang Wu received his BS from Beijing University of Posts and Telecommunications in 1993, MS from Peking University in 1996, and PhD from Colorado State University in 2002, all in electrical engineering. He worked as a research engineer for Chinese Academy for Telecommunication Technologies (CATT) from 1996 to 1998. He also worked at West Virginia University Institute of Technology as an assistant professor from 2003 to 2005. He joined Wright State University in 2005 and currently serves as a full professor. He also serves as the co-director of the Center of Excellence on Sensor System Engineering of the state of Ohio. Dr. Wu is the author of national CDMA network management standard of China. He also co-authored one of the first books on multi-carrier transmission technologies for wireless communication. He has published more than 150 technical papers in journals and conferences. He has served as Chair of Acoustic Communication Interest Group of IEEE Technical Committee on Multimedia Communications. His research has been supported by the National Science Foundation, Air Force Office of Scientific Research, Air Force Research Laboratory, Office of Naval Research, and NASA. His work on software defined radio implementation of cognitive radio received the Best Demo Award at IEEE Globecom 2010.
